Changes in the etiolated tobacco leaf during greening. IV. Carbon dioxide fixation
HARRIS J.B.; NAYLOR A.W.
Biology Department, Wisconsin State University, Stevens Point, Wisconsin USA; Botany Department, Duke University, Durham, North Carolina USA
